Man shoots down neighbour's pet dog; arrested

Image

Press Trust of India Namakkal (TN)
A 49-year-old man was arrested here today for allegedly killing his neighbour's dog this morning after being annoyed over its barking in Vellalapatty Suriyamangalam locality in Tiruchengode, police said.

The accused Arthanari shot the dog with his country-made gun today morning. On dog's owner Karthik, complaint he was later arrested and his gun was seized, they said.

During questioning, he said the dog used to bark at him whenever he use to cross by his house and also attempted to bite him and hence he killed it.

Police registered a case under IPC section 429 (Mischief by killing or maiming cattle, etc), Arms Act for possessing unlicenced gun and the Prevention of Cruelty to Animals Act.
 

Arthanari was produced before a magistrate court in Tiruchengode which remanded him to judicial custody for 15 days.

The dog was sent for post-mortem at the local animal husbandry hospital, they added.
